Canonical is a leading provider of open source software and operating systems to the global enterprise and technology markets. Our platform, Ubuntu, is very widely used in breakthrough enterprise initiatives such as public cloud, data science, AI, engineering innovation, and IoT. Our customers include the world's leading public cloud and silicon providers, and industry leaders in many sectors. The company is a pioneer of global distributed collaboration, with 1200+ colleagues in 75+ countries and very few office-based roles. Teams meet two to four times yearly in person, in interesting locations around the world, to align on strategy and execution.

The company is founder-led, profitable, and growing.

Ubuntu Server is the world's most popular Linux - on cloud and bare metal. In this role, you will manage the team delivering the Ubuntu Server Distribution to the world.

Ubuntu strives to offer the latest, best, free software components, in an easy to use and highly reliable form. We build on the technical excellence of Debian and bring additional focus and shape to the solutions we provide to industry. The successful applicant will be passionate about the future of Ubuntu, mindful of the dynamics of the open source ecosystem, and aware of the needs of large, innovative customers.
